Agronomists are mainly engaged in seed selection, introduction, propagation, cultivation, tillage reform, growth regulators, soil investigation, soil fertilizer measurement, soil improvement and utilization, fertilizer utilization and new fertilizer research and development, land use planning and management, soil environmental protection, pest prediction and prevention, plant quarantine, pesticide quality and residue detection, pesticide and plant protection machinery development, etc. Agricultural environmental quality inspection, management and protection, cocoon harvesting and drying, quality inspection of agricultural products, storage and processing of agricultural products, planning and design, technical research and popularization, scientific and technological management and education, service system construction, agricultural legal system construction, agricultural industrialization management and other technical work.
